A Beginner’s Guide to Visiting a Karaoke Bar

 
Visiting a karaoke bar for the primary time can feel exciting, a little intimidating, and numerous fun. Karaoke bars are popular social venues where people gather to sing their favorite songs in front of an audience. Whether or not you like performing or just wish to enjoy a lively evening out with friends, karaoke presents an entertaining experience for everyone. Understanding how karaoke bars work may also help inexperienced persons feel more comfortable and ready to participate.
 
 
A karaoke bar is a venue that provides music tracks with lyrics displayed on a screen while guests sing along using a microphone. Most karaoke songs remove the lead vocals but keep the instrumental background, allowing singers to perform the music themselves. The lyrics seem on screens throughout the bar so each the singer and the audience can observe along.
 
 
Many karaoke bars operate with a host, often called a KJ or karaoke jockey. The host manages the track queue, calls singers to the stage, and keeps the occasion organized. Once you arrive at a karaoke bar, you will typically receive a songbook or access to a digital catalog. These lists include hundreds and even hundreds of songs throughout different genres comparable to pop, rock, country, hip hop, and basic hits.
 
 
Selecting your first karaoke music is a crucial step. Rookies typically really feel more assured deciding on a track they already know well. Familiar lyrics and melodies make it easier to deal with enjoying the performance instead of worrying about remembering the words. Well-liked newbie karaoke songs are often upbeat and widely recognized, which helps create a supportive ambiance from the crowd.
 
 
After deciding on your music, you usually write your name and the track title on a request slip or submit the request through a digital system. The karaoke host adds your tune to the rotation. Depending on how busy the bar is, you might wait wherever from a few minutes to half an hour before your turn.
 
 
While waiting, take a while to observe how others perform. Karaoke bars are known for their relaxed and friendly environment. Many people aren't professional singers, and the viewers usually applauds anyone who has the braveness to get on stage. This welcoming ambiance makes karaoke an incredible activity for beginners.
 
 
When your name is called, head to the stage and take the microphone. The screen will display the lyrics in time with the music, guiding you through the song. Give attention to having enjoyable moderately than trying to sing perfectly. Confidence and enthusiasm typically matter more than vocal ability in a karaoke setting.
 
 
Karaoke etiquette is easy but important. Respect different performers by listening throughout their songs and applauding when they finish. Keep away from interrupting the stage while someone else is singing. If you plan to sing a number of songs, wait until others have had an opportunity to perform before submitting another request.
 
 
Some karaoke bars also offer private karaoke rooms. These rooms permit groups of friends to sing collectively in a smaller, more private setting. This option is especially interesting for rookies who could feel nervous about performing in entrance of a large crowd.
 
 
Food and drinks are one other widespread function of karaoke bars. Many venues serve cocktails, beer, and snacks that guests can enjoy while listening to performances. A relaxed drink can help ease stage nerves, however moderation helps ensure the experience stays enjoyable.
 
 
Karaoke continues to develop in popularity all over the world because it combines music, social interplay, and entertainment. A first visit to a karaoke bar could really feel nerve racking, but most newcomers quickly discover that the experience is way more fun than intimidating. With a fantastic track alternative, supportive friends, and a lively crowd, karaoke can simply grow to be one of the most memorable nights out.
